Стоимость создания приложения для доставки продуктов по запросу, такого как Instacart

Опубликовано: 2021-10-05

Там, где есть спрос, рано или поздно будет и предложение. Поэтому неудивительно, что с быстрым развитием мобильных технологий появляются приложения для службы доставки продуктов. Исследования eMarketer показывают, что тенденция онлайн-заказа еды будет продолжать расти.

Я просто не могу уместить все, что мне нужно, за 24 часа. Я бы хотел, чтобы кто-нибудь покупал за меня продукты, чтобы я могла передохнуть.

Что такое приложение для доставки продуктов по запросу и как оно работает?

Как следует из названия, приложения для доставки продуктов позволяют клиентам заказывать продукты (или другие продукты), которые будут доставлены к их порогу. Сама по себе услуга, конечно, не нова, но переход на мобильные устройства сделал ее намного более доступной и, следовательно, широко распространенной. Вам больше не нужно нанимать домашнего работника для доставки продуктов; все, что вам нужно, находится всего в паре нажатий.

доставка продуктов по запросу

Вкратце, разработка приложения для доставки продуктов похожа на разработку любого другого приложения, предлагающего услуги по запросу. Например, Uber. Фактически, у Uber есть собственная служба доставки еды по запросу, Uber Eats. Если вы решите заняться бизнесом по доставке продуктов в США, Uber Eats станет одним из ваших основных конкурентов наряду с Instacart и Postmates.

Если вам интересно , вы можете узнать больше о разработке приложений для доставки еды здесь. Как создать приложение, подобное Postmates.

Но если вы правильно разработаете свое приложение с хорошей командой, вы, вероятно, сможете сразиться с этими гигантами.

Служба онлайн-доставки обычно включает в себя два приложения - приложение для клиентов и отдельное приложение для локальной доставки для тех, кто осуществляет доставку. Когда клиент размещает заказ в своем приложении и оплачивает его, с другой стороны, сотрудник службы доставки, находящийся поблизости, видит этот заказ в приложении доставки, принимает заказ и выполняет его, доставляя товар покупателю.

Технически в одном приложении можно объединить функции, необходимые клиентам и работникам службы доставки, но это сделает ваше приложение громоздким. Это вряд ли эффективный подход.

Совет, о котором следует помнить, прежде чем начинать разработку продуктового онлайн-приложения

начало разработки продуктового онлайн-приложения

Для приложения продуктового магазина есть две модели доставки по запросу:

  1. У службы доставки есть собственный магазин с товарами, которые они доставляют.
  2. Служба доставки сотрудничает с рядом различных магазинов и осуществляет доставку для них.

Например, у Walmart есть собственное приложение, и у компании также есть служба доставки, хотя она доступна не везде.

Другие магазины, такие как Costco , сотрудничают с такими сервисами, как Instacart, чтобы доставить им товары. Установив партнерские отношения с магазином, вы получите доступ к его запасам и данным о ценах, а также сможете добавлять товары магазина в свое приложение. Технически реализовать это можно несколькими способами.

Вы, конечно, можете отказаться от партнерства и просто доставлять товары по запросу, не указывая, в каком магазине они поступают. Так началось с Instacart. Однако это бесконечно сложнее; для начала вам нужно будет предоставить свои собственные фотографии продукта. Кроме того, некоторые покупатели предпочитают конкретные магазины и хотели бы, чтобы их товары доставляли оттуда и никуда.

Функции мобильного приложения продуктового магазина, которые нужно включить в свой MVP

Разработка мобильного приложения для доставки продуктов

Поскольку в целом приложения для доставки продуктов не особо инновационны, тратить целое состояние на запуск полной версии без надлежащих исследований и подготовки было бы пустой тратой. Прежде чем погрузиться в разработку, вы и ваша компания по разработке продуктового приложения должны оценить свою идею и найти уникальное ценностное предложение. Далее идет MVP или минимально жизнеспособный продукт.

Клиентское приложение

  • Профиль пользователя
  • Список магазинов
  • Меню / товары на складе
  • Корзина / страница заказа
  • Платежный шлюз
  • Статус заказа
  • История заказов
  • Уведомления

Приложение доставки

  • Профиль
  • Список заказов (с указанием позиций и адресов доставки)
  • Карта для навигации

Панель администратора

  • Данные клиентов
  • Список магазинов
  • Меню / товары на складе
  • Доход

Естественно, чтобы клиентские приложения и приложения доставки работали должным образом, им необходимо взаимодействовать в режиме реального времени, чтобы доставка не занимала слишком много времени. Преимущество любого приложения для покупок продуктов заключается в том, что служба доставит заказ вовремя. Чтобы обеспечить обмен данными между приложениями, вам потребуются API-интерфейсы WebSocket на вашем сервере.

Вам также понадобятся способы предоставить списки товаров с текущими ценами в магазинах, из которых вы доставляете товары.

Дополнительные функции, которые вы можете включить при разработке мобильного приложения для покупок продуктов

В Mind Studios мы предпочитаем концепцию минимально привлекательного продукта (MLP) MVP. Разработка MLP означает, что, помимо самого необходимого, ваше приложение также будет иметь функцию подписи, которая выделяет его из толпы аналогичных приложений для доставки продуктов по запросу. Вот несколько предложений относительно того, какими могут быть эти функции :

  • Разрешите своим клиентам регистрироваться в социальных сетях, таких как Facebook, или автоматически регистрироваться по электронной почте без необходимости проходить процесс регистрации. Это упростит и ускорит регистрацию ваших клиентов, сделав их более склонными к взаимодействию с вашим приложением.

  • Добавьте альтернативный вариант. С помощью поля альтернатив покупатели могут установить возможную замену, если товар недоступен. Это улучшит взаимодействие с пользователем, поскольку будет меньше случаев частично выполненных заказов.

Возможности приложения в стиле Instacart

  • Сделайте чат-бота. Есть множество способов реализовать чат-ботов. Чат-бот может показывать вашим клиентам (и сотрудникам службы доставки) ценную информацию о товарах и магазинах или предлагать популярные рецепты с выбранным товаром.

  • Ваши занятые клиенты высоко оценят распознавание голоса, так как они смогут размещать заказы на ходу, не останавливаясь и не вводя название продукта или не просматривая инвентарь магазина.

  • Поддержка клиентов по телефону или в чате - еще одна хорошая идея, будь то техническая поддержка по работе с приложением или возможность связаться с доставщиком, чтобы внести изменения в заказ в последнюю минуту.

  • Позвольте вашим клиентам оставлять оценки и отзывы о каждой доставке. Таким образом, вы можете следить за своими работниками по доставке и за производительностью вашего приложения. Вы также можете добавить аналогичную функцию в приложение доставки, чтобы фильтровать клиентов, вызывающих проблемы. Это один из способов узнать, как обстоят дела в вашей компании.

Любые дополнительные функции, естественно, повлияют на стоимость разработки продуктового приложения, но они также могут стать уникальным преимуществом, которое поможет привлечь внимание к вашему сервису.

Как службы доставки по запросу зарабатывают деньги?

Когда вы думаете о том, как сделать продуктовое приложение, вы неизбежно сталкиваетесь с вопросом о том, как получить прибыль. Разработка приложения стоит недешево, и вам также нужно будет платить людям, которые доставляют его. Кроме того, вы начали бизнес, чтобы зарабатывать деньги, верно?

Владельцам служб доставки продуктов по запросу доступно несколько вариантов монетизации.

  1. Вы можете добавить плату за свои услуги к цене каждого товара. То есть вы можете установить цену на каждый товар немного выше, чем реальная цена в магазине. Имейте в виду, что если вы сделаете это, вам нужно будет четко проинформировать своих пользователей о повышенных ценах, если вы хотите выглядеть честным и прозрачным. Создайте уведомление, которое появляется, когда клиенты впервые размещают заказ или начинают просматривать каталог. Кроме того, включите напоминание в свою политику.

  2. Взимайте плату за доставку. Это самая распространенная модель монетизации. С ваших клиентов взимается плата за товары в соответствии с фактическими ценами в магазине, а затем взимается плата за доставку. В зависимости от размера заказа и расстояния от магазина до покупателя доставщику может понадобиться машина или он сможет воспользоваться общественным транспортом. Вы можете установить базовую ставку и включить функцию автоматического расчета фактической ставки.

  3. Объявления. Эта модель монетизации наблюдается повсюду. Многие приложения включают рекламу, которая может покрывать расходы и позволяет компаниям взимать меньшую плату за услуги, к полному удовольствию своих клиентов (или нет).

  4. Заряжайте магазины, чтобы они отображались на вашей платформе. Если ваше приложение уже пользуется популярностью, вы можете взимать ежемесячную плату с магазинов, которые будут сотрудничать с вами и отображать их продукты на вашей платформе. Взамен магазины получат узнаваемость бренда и больше покупателей.

Вы можете использовать одну модель монетизации или объединить несколько.

Стоимость создания такого приложения, как Instacart

Теперь, когда мы рассмотрели функции и вы знаете, как разработать приложение для доставки продуктов, давайте попробуем оценить стоимость разработки. Точная цена будет зависеть от множества факторов, от сложности приложения до вашего выбора разработчиков, но мы можем дать приблизительную цифру для основных функций.

Если вы работаете с аутсорсинговой компанией-разработчиком и планируете использовать как платформы Android, так и iOS, вам нужно нанять эту команду:

  • 1 руководитель проекта
  • 1-2 разработчика Android
  • 1-2 разработчика iOS
  • 1-2 дизайнера UI / UX
  • 2 QA специалиста
  • 1 backend разработчик

Вы можете отказаться от менеджера проекта, если решите работать с отдельными внештатными разработчиками. Однако мы считаем, что менеджеры проектов являются важным звеном, которое связывает все вместе, и их вклад в создание вашего приложения может быть лучшим, что когда-либо случалось с вашим проектом.

Узнайте больше о процессе разработки мобильных приложений для запуска успешных приложений в 2020 году.

При создании двух отдельных приложений, каждое со своим дизайном и набором функций, время, необходимое для создания продуктового приложения, также зависит от количества людей в вашей команде. Если вы решите работать с командой, подобной описанной выше, мы рассчитываем, что это займет не менее 1700 часов работы:

Стадия развития Часы
Открытие 80+
Проверка идеи 40+
Визуальное прототипирование 60
Дизайн для платформ Android и iOS 130–190
iOS разработка 600–800
Разработка под Android 500–800
Backend разработка 300+
Разработка админ панели 60
Общий: 1770–2330+

При средней цене около 35 долларов в час стоимость такого приложения, как Instacart, будет начинаться с 62000 долларов и будет расти в зависимости от используемых функций и технологий.

У вас остались вопросы о том, как создать приложение, подобное Instacart, или вы хотите получить более точную смету? Мы всегда здесь , готовы ответить на любые ваши вопросы.